Stars
- All languages
- Assembly
- Blade
- C
- C#
- C++
- CMake
- CSS
- Chapel
- Clojure
- CoffeeScript
- Common Lisp
- Crystal
- Dart
- Dockerfile
- Elixir
- Emacs Lisp
- Erlang
- F#
- Flix
- Frege
- Go
- Groovy
- HTML
- Haskell
- Java
- JavaScript
- Kotlin
- Lua
- MDX
- Makefile
- Markdown
- Nim
- OCaml
- PHP
- Perl
- Pug
- Python
- Racket
- ReScript
- Ruby
- Rust
- SCSS
- Scala
- Scheme
- Shell
- Swift
- TSQL
- TypeScript
- V
- Vala
- Vim Script
- YASnippet
- Zig
- edn
An idiomatic Go (golang) validation package. Supports configurable and extensible validation rules (validators) using normal language constructs instead of error-prone struct tags.
lightweight, idiomatic and composable router for building Go HTTP services
JSONSchema (draft 2020-12, draft 2019-09, draft-7, draft-6, draft-4) Validation using Go
Incredibly fast JavaScript runtime, bundler, test runner, and package manager – all in one
Building a Secure and Interoperable Future for AI-Driven Payments.
A dependency injection based application framework for Go.
Podman: A tool for managing OCI containers and pods.
Tiny Reagent-compatible-ish Squint-cljs UIs with no React
LangChain for Go, the easiest way to write LLM-based programs in Go
Object oriented framework and core library for GNU C. Inspired by Objective-C. Zlib license.
Arena Allocator implementation in pure C as an stb-style single-file library.
Super small, simple, and (almost) completely C89-compliant single-header arena "allocator".
A cheatsheet of modern C language and library features.
📚 single header utf8 string functions for C and C++
The new nanopass framework; an embedded DSL for writing compilers in Scheme
An implementation of the Kaleidoscope language using Flex, Bison & the LLVM-C bindings.
Repository for the book "Crafting Interpreters"
Static reflection for enums (to string, from string, iteration) for modern C++, work with any enum type without any macro or boilerplate code
Smart pointers for the (GNU) C programming language
Higher level utilities over Clojure core.async that let you use an async style of programming with ease.
A task runner / simpler Make alternative written in Go
Standard Go Project Layout
⛓️RuleGo is a lightweight, high-performance, embedded, next-generation component orchestration rule engine framework for Go.